Believe it,do it!

Ideal is the beacon. Without ideal, there is no secure direction; without direction ,there is no life.
理想是指路明灯。没有理想,就没有坚定的方向;没有方向,就没有生活。
CTRL+T eclipse
posts - 35, comments - 3, trackbacks - 0, articles - 0
  BlogJava :: 首页 :: 新随笔 :: 联系 :: 聚合  :: 管理

部署程序svn及eclipse

Posted on 2010-01-21 15:26 三羽 阅读(1103) 评论(1)  编辑  收藏 所属分类: JAVA资料

一、去掉SVN文件夹
1、建立一个文本文件,取名为kill-svn-folders.reg,内容如下:

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\SOFTWARE\Classes\Folder\shell\DeleteSVN]
@="Delete .SVN Folders"

[HKEY_LOCAL_MACHINE\SOFTWARE\Classes\Folder\shell\DeleteSVN\command]
@="cmd.exe /c \"TITLE Removing SVN Folders in %1 && COLOR 9A && FOR /r \"%1\" %%f IN (.svn) DO RD /s /q \"%%f\" \""

保存之后,双击这个reg文件。成功后,在每一个文件夹上点击右键都会有一个“Delete .SVN Folders”的选项,点击之后,既可以删除这个文件下下面所有的.svn文件了.

2. 使用svn自带的export功能。export导出的是一份不带.svn的纯净的代码。

二、svn导出不同版本文件
TortoiseSVN  →  Repo-browser →  根目录上右键Show log →  按Ctrl间选两个日志版本对比右键Compare revisions →  选要导出的文件右键 Export selection to...

三、eclipse导出war包
eclipse打包是需要TOMCAT插件支持的.
1.在项目上点右键->properties,
2 在'Tomcat'下'export to war settings选项卡,'
3.输入要导出的war文件路径和文件名,确定,返回项目
4.在项目上点右键->tomcat project->Export to the war file sets in project properties生成WAR包


评论

# re: 部署程序svn及eclipse  回复  更多评论   

2010-09-07 23:30 by eppen
如果代码是用svn管理的那么,当是用tomcat plugin导出war的时候,svn的控制信息好像会被一起导出;而用cvs管理的代码使用tomcat plugin导出war的时候cvs的控制信息并不会被导出。
svn管理的和时候如何才能导出war的时候不带svn控制信息。?

只有注册用户登录后才能发表评论。


网站导航: